Road repairs in Pasig, Quezon City resume this weekend

The Metro Manila Development Authority on Friday announced the resumption of road reblocking and other repairs along major thoroughfares in Pasig City and Quezon City this weekend.

MMDA chairman Emerson Carlos said the Department of Public Works and Highways will undertake road reblocking and repairs starting 11 p.m. Friday until Jan. 18, at the following areas:

• First southbound lane of Service Road between Aurora Boulevard and P. Tuazon Street in Quezon City.

• Second northbound outermost lane of Circumferential Road–5 (C-5 Road) in front of SM Warehouse Gate 2 in Pasig City, and

• First northbound lane of Epifanio de los Santos Avenue in front of the DPWH–Second Engineering District Office, also in Quezon City.

Carlos gave the permission to continue the road works after DPWH-National Capital Region director Melvin Navarro asked the MMDA a go signal for maintenance purposes. He added motorists are advised to avoid the affected areas and use alternate routes instead.

“All affected roads will be fully passable by 5 a.m. on Monday,” he said.

Last week, the DPWH also conducted road repairs along the first southbound lane of Edsa between Mother Ignacia Street and Eugenio Lopez; northbound outermost lane of C-5 Road from Shell Gas Station to SM Warehouse Gate 2, and second northbound lane of Edsa fronting the DPWH-SED Office.

Carlos urged the DPWH to monitor  contractors who reportedly work beyond their approved schedules, stressing that delays cause inconvenience to the public. 

Last month, the MMDA imposed a two-week moratorium on road diggings and excavations in the metropolis in anticipation of the heavy vehicular and pedestrian traffic during the holiday travel rush.

The temporary stoppage of road works, totaling 146 all around Metro Manila, was implemented from Dec. 14, 2015 up to midnight of Jan. 3.
